About Unit 3: Booleans
- Learning Targets:
- Boolean logic is a fundamental concept in computer science that deals with the manipulation and evaluation of true or false values
- Named after the mathematician George Boole, who developed the algebraic system of logic in the 19th century
- Boolean expressions are used to make decisions and control the flow of a program based on certain conditions
- Why is it important:
- Boolean logic is essential for implementing conditional statements, loops, and other control structures in programming
- Allows programmers to create complex decision-making processes and algorithms
- Understanding boolean logic is crucial for writing efficient and effective code in various programming languages, including Java
